Defective Device

Why would you cross the line
Why wouldn't you take your time
Take a look at this stick
Turning around your heels
Soon it will make its prick
Right deep inside your skin
Swiftly... Oh, but slowly.
It should hurt you badly
We're falling to the pith now
Together, let's hit the ground.

Now we're scattered cause we're broken
No more chances, our hearts' open
I am done
You are gone
But bottomline,
It's a good fight
We're the only thing we made right

Have we lost?
Have we lost?

Point me just beside you
I wanna stay with you
Cause I should've told you
It's leading me to you
Though my hands can't reach you
Why, I adore you...
I brought my bones discord
For when I said the words-
And plead for your attention,
I've lost the right direction.
